# AMQP Output Plugin
|
||||
|
||||
This plugin writes to a AMQP exchange using tag, defined in configuration file
|
||||
as RoutingTag, as a routing key.
|
||||
|
||||
If RoutingTag is empty, then empty routing key will be used.
|
||||
Metrics are grouped in batches by RoutingTag.
|
||||
|
||||
This plugin doesn't bind exchange to a queue, so it should be done by consumer.
